The Effect of Prenatal Exposure to Nicotine versus Thiocyanate on Pituitary-Testicular Axis of Juvenile Albino Rats: A Comparative Histological and Electron Microscopic Study

Abstract: Cigarette smoking prevalence is still increasing in the developing world especially among men mainly in central Asia, east Europe and Africa. Furthermore, maternal cigarette smoking during pregnancy has multiple deleterious effects on the offspring, which may persist into adulthood.
